Output ef5ef8bf0000f391d4f47439e03e7c45433884b914fbd594aec81c15cee99bcb:80

value
26688140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4bb54a2fa583ce7cfa9f2f67664ec68113853a9 OP_EQUALVERIFY OP_CHECKSIG
address
1LPpfdNiXokbsrrQCqQUJ7HmtM3st5ooJD
transaction
ef5ef8bf0000f391d4f47439e03e7c45433884b914fbd594aec81c15cee99bcb
spent
true